๐ฑ Did you know? Venus flytraps donโt actually NEED you to hand-feed them to survive! Theyโre carnivorous but get most of their energy from photosynthesis โ just like any other plant. The bugs they catch act more like a natural fertilizer (extra nitrogen & nutrients) that helps them grow bigger traps and stay extra healthy. โ If your flytrap is outdoors in full sun: It will catch plenty of flies, ants, and spiders on its own. You rarely need to do anything! โ Indoors: You can feed it occasionally (1-2 small bugs per month max, like a fly or bloodworm) if you want faster growth. But donโt overdo it โ triggering too many traps wastes the plantโs energy. Pro tips for happy flytraps: โข Use only distilled, rainwater, or RO water (tap water kills them with minerals) โข Bright direct sunlight (or strong grow lights) โ 8+ hours a day โข Nutrient-free soil (peat moss + perlite mix) โข Never use fertilizer!
